How To Find A Good Plumber

Recommendation

Despite all the technological advances over the past few decades, word-of-mouth is still one of the most reliable methods of finding a tradesperson. That’s why the first thing most people do when they need a plumber is to ask their closest friends, family, and next door neighbours.

Experience

Just like with almost every other trade, you want a plumber who has plenty of experience before they start working in your home. So you should search for a plumber who has been in business for a few years and can show that their industry service is reliable, trusted, and stable.

Qualifications

All plumbers have to complete an apprenticeship in order for them to become a licensed tradie. So, always ask them about their qualifications when they show up and if you’re unsure, you can always check their plumbing licence before allowing them to work in your home.

Other Tradies

If you already have tradies or handymen that you use and you trust, you can always ask them if they deal with a plumber they can recommend to you. Tradies and other businesses often work together with each other on big projects, and professional people will always prefer to work with other professionals. That’s why you can usually rely on their advice.

Reviews

Online reviews will usually give you an idea about how well certain plumbing companies have performed with other customers. As long as the majority of a plumber’s reviews are positive overall, you can usually feel much better about choosing them to work for you.

Insurance

One of the most important things you should consider before hiring a plumber is whether they’re insured. Ask to see copies of their insurance before they start work to ensure you’re covered just in case anything goes wrong.

Interpersonal Skills

By choosing a plumber that you get along with, you will most likely be happy with getting them back again in the future if you need plumbing repairs or other work done.
